How they compare
Czechia currently reports 0.1% against 0.1% in Russian Federation, a difference of 0.0%.
That makes Czechia's figure about 1.7 times Russian Federation's.
Across all 11 years both countries report, Czechia has been ahead every year.
Czechia ranks 40th and Russian Federation ranks 43rd of 49 countries.
Czechia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Official development assistance (ODA) divided by gross national income, expressed as a percentage. This is the official estimate that combines net disbursements with grant equivalents from 2018.
